What Materials Are Sculptures Made From?
The material is the most significant factor determining a sculpture's longevity. Some materials are inherently more durable than others.
-
Bronze: Bronze sculptures, known for their strength and resistance to corrosion, can last for thousands of years. Many ancient bronze sculptures have survived to this day, testament to their durability. Proper care and maintenance, however, still prolong their lifespan.
-
Marble: Marble is a beautiful but relatively fragile material. It's susceptible to weathering and erosion, especially in outdoor environments. Acid rain and pollution can significantly damage marble sculptures over time. Indoor preservation offers considerably longer life.
-
Stone (other types): Granite, limestone, and sandstone all possess varying degrees of durability. Granite, for example, is significantly more resistant to weathering than limestone. The specific type of stone and its inherent porosity affect its longevity.
-
Wood: Wooden sculptures are inherently less durable than stone or bronze. They are vulnerable to decay, insect infestation, and environmental factors like moisture. Proper preservation techniques, including treating the wood with preservatives and controlling humidity, are crucial.
-
Clay/Terracotta: These are fragile materials susceptible to cracking and breakage. Outdoor placement drastically reduces their lifespan compared to indoor display. Firing (in the case of terracotta) significantly increases durability.
-
Modern Materials: Contemporary sculptors use a wide range of materials, including fiberglass, resin, plastics, and mixed media. The durability of these varies greatly depending on the specific materials and techniques used.
How Does the Environment Affect Sculpture Lifespan?
The environment plays a critical role in determining how long a sculpture will survive.
-
Outdoor vs. Indoor: Sculptures placed outdoors are far more vulnerable to the elements. Exposure to sun, rain, wind, and temperature fluctuations accelerates weathering and erosion. Indoor sculptures, kept in stable conditions, have a considerably longer lifespan.
-
Climate: Hot, humid climates accelerate the deterioration of many materials, particularly wood and stone. Cold, freezing temperatures can also cause damage through freeze-thaw cycles. Pollution levels significantly impact the lifespan of stone sculptures, as acid rain corrodes the surface.
-
Exposure to Pollution: Industrial pollution, especially acid rain, drastically shortens the lifespan of many materials, particularly marble and stone.
How Can We Preserve Sculptures?
Proper preservation methods can significantly extend a sculpture's lifespan. These techniques vary depending on the material:
-
Cleaning: Regular cleaning helps remove dirt, grime, and pollutants that can damage the surface.
-
Consolidation: This involves strengthening weakened or damaged areas of a sculpture using specialized adhesives or consolidants.
-
Protection: Protecting sculptures from the elements is crucial. This might involve creating shelters, applying protective coatings, or moving them indoors.
-
Environmental Control: Maintaining stable temperature and humidity levels is essential for preventing deterioration.

What are the most common causes of sculpture deterioration?
The most common causes of sculpture deterioration include weathering (sun, rain, wind, temperature fluctuations), pollution (acid rain, industrial emissions), biological factors (moss, lichen, insects), and physical damage (accidental impacts, vandalism).
What are the best ways to protect sculptures from the elements?
Protecting sculptures from the elements involves several strategies, including creating protective shelters, applying weather-resistant coatings, using UV-resistant materials during construction, and regularly cleaning and maintaining the sculptures to remove pollutants.
Can you give examples of sculptures that have lasted for a long time?
Many ancient sculptures have survived for thousands of years, including numerous bronze and stone sculptures from ancient Greece and Rome. Examples include the Venus de Milo and numerous statues from the Acropolis. However, even these ancient sculptures have experienced some degree of deterioration over time.
